Assessments

Online mental health assessments are an excellent method to determine if you are suffering from an illness of the mind and find treatment options. These tools are easy to use and can help you determine whether your symptoms are due to a medical condition that is treatable like anxiety or depression. These tests will inquire about your symptoms and how they impact you and your family history. Answering these questions honestly is vital. The more precise you are, the higher your chances of receiving an accurate diagnosis. You should be prepared to talk about any medications you are currently taking or have taken previously. Certain drugs can affect your mood or your thoughts and you should inform your doctor all details about your health condition.

A thorough online psychological assessment can be conducted in a matter of minutes. It is a great alternative to traditional face-to-face psychological evaluations which can be costly and time-consuming. These online assessment tools can be used to screen for depression, anxiety, and other disorders. They will help you make an informed decision about the best treatment option for your situation.

These assessments also permit therapists to monitor their clients' progress and monitor well-being. These data are invaluable for their practice and can assist them in developing targeted intervention and promote client engagement. The digital format of these assessments also allows for standardization of data collection, which can reduce errors and increase efficiency. Additionally, these assessments can integrate with existing systems, like electronic health record (EHR) systems and practice management software.

When choosing an online psychological assessment tool, make sure you choose one that has been rigorously verified and tested. These processes involve comparing the results of the tool to established clinical standards and other validated measures. This ensures that the tool accurately evaluates its claims and is free of bias. Be sure that the tool is available on multiple devices and platforms such as smartphones, tablets, computers and other mobile devices.

Despite the growing acceptance of these tests however, they are not without their limitations. For example, they may not accurately identify the signs of mental illness or predict when a person will seek help. They also do not reflect the experiences of all people. Additionally, there is a risk of misdiagnosis and over-treatment.

Reports

Clinicians utilize psychiatric assessment tools to identify symptoms and determine the underlying causes of mental disorders. They usually consist of questionnaires and interviews that evaluate the severity, presence of, frequency, and duration of a wide range of symptoms. These instruments are based on a specific classification system and they only cover the most common symptoms. This can lead to inconsistent diagnosis and hinder research into the underlying causes of psychiatric disorder.

Assessment tools online have transformed the landscape for psychiatric diagnosis and assessment. These instruments are designed to collect information and present a report of the user's results within a matter of minutes. They also allow the user to the closest, top-quality treatment provider. They also allow the user to track their progress over time and can help them monitor the changes in symptoms.

Self-assessments on the internet can be a great tool to spot certain signs. However, they should not replace a thorough assessment by a mental health professional. They could even cause a misdiagnosis because the results of these assessments are often misleading when not taken into consideration with other factors, such as the patient's background and life events.

Additionally it is possible that the use of various assessment tools by different doctors can also lead to confusion in diagnosis, since these tools typically focus on specific symptoms and do not necessarily cover all aspects of a disorder's presentation. This is particularly important in the case of atypical presentations of mental illnesses that are more prevalent in the elderly population and tend to have a overlapping symptom pattern with other diseases.

Technology is helping lower the barriers to mental healthcare and make it more accessible than ever. The use of assessment tools that are digital is rapidly expanding as more healthcare professionals recognize the potential of these powerful and innovative tools to improve access to psychiatric aged care mental health assessment for patients. Digital tools also offer greater cost efficiency, convenience and data collection capacity while reducing the time needed for in-person clinical assessments.

Treatment options

Online assessments of occupational mental health assessment health can aid in identifying mental disorders. The tests give users results they can share with their therapist or psychiatrist with, along with recommendations for treatment options. Additionally, they provide users with links to local, quality care providers. It is crucial to remember that online tests are just one aspect of the whole. The most important factor for an outcome that is positive is to continue the therapy and to have the support of family and friends.

Psychotherapy and psychiatric medications are the most commonly used treatments for mental health crisis assessment service illness. These treatments can be utilized either in conjunction or as a stand-alone. Psychotherapy, also known as talk therapy, aids people who have a variety of disorders, including anxiety and depression. These treatments may be individual in that the person is the only person in the room with a therapist or they can be group therapy. Group therapy is a frequent gathering of a small group of patients to discuss their concerns. It can be extremely helpful to know that others have the same problems and to hear their stories.

Other forms of therapy include interpersonal psychotherapy, family psychotherapy, cognitive behavioral therapy and various other forms. CBT and IPT help people learn to change their thought patterns, behaviors and relationships. They can also teach people how to manage stress and improve their coping abilities. Family therapy can be a great way to work with loved ones to address issues and develop healthy relationships.

Some people have such serious mental issues that they require care in a residential treatment facility or a hospital. This kind of treatment is temporary and designed to help stabilize the patient. This can be an option for those who are suicidal or are at risk of harming themselves.

A number of studies have demonstrated that online interventions for mental disorders could be cost-effective (Baumann et al., 2020; Donker et al., 2015; Ophuis et al. 2017). However, these studies have largely limited their economic evaluations to a social perspective and did not differentiate between the costs of the system and those of the patient. This lack of knowledge hinders the ability of policymakers to be informed about the cost-effectiveness of digital interventions in mental health.

Although many online mental health assessments can be helpful but users must be cautious when taking these tests. Some tests that seem amusing could be ruses to collect personal information like passwords. The data could be sold to advertisers or even used to guess the passwords of a person. Therefore, it is essential to only go to websites that are trustworthy and read carefully their privacy policies.

A growing number of telepsychiatry companies provide affordable, convenient services. Some offer low charges for follow-up visits while others offer a discounted fee for patients with insurance. On their websites, many telepsychiatry clinics list the insurance plans that they accept. If your insurance plan does not cover telepsychiatry, you can think about alternatives to pay for your services, like the HSA or FSA.
